![]() Cabined Accounts will automatically be unable to communicate through voice or text chat, purchase items with money, download games that aren't owned by Epic Games, get recommendations based on activity, receive push notifications, trade in Rocket League, use custom display names, utilize SMS two-factor authentication or link accounts to external services. The Epic Games launcher itself will be accessible as children wait for the parental consent process, but they won't be able to use certain features until limits are lifted by parents that choose to do so.Įpic Games began rolling out the account changes with a December 7 update which may suggest that if someone hasn't gotten the change on their copy of Fortnite, Fall Guys, or Rocket League yet, it may be coming in the next few days. Should these gamers be below the age of eighteen, they will also be asked for a parent or guardian's email address in order for parental controls to be properly implemented, but adult players will continue to follow the standard protocol. RELATED: Parent Has Perfect Solution to Keep Child From Turning Off XboxAccording to Epic Games, each of the titles receiving the Cabined Accounts will prompt players once to enter their age when they launch the game. Although consoles and games like Minecraft offer parental controls that can allow guardians to implement limitations for playing the aforementioned games, many kids are able to circumnavigate things, but these Cabined Accounts could make that a little bit harder. Age restrictions have been prominently used across the internet since its early days and although there are some ways for fans to work around the system, it's a preventative measure from harmful content reaching children. ![]() Fortnite, Fall Guys, and Rocket League have all received a recent change that has introduced an age-restricted account for kids known as Cabined Accounts. Since the early days of Fortnite, the battle royale has been significantly successful among the younger audience and Epic Games continues to look for ways to keep kids safe from malicious actors, and are even opening the door to Item Shop limits. Once your accounts are linked, you can't unlink your Epic Games account again for another six months. The new EA Account you link to can't have been linked to an Epic Games account before. ![]() You can unlink your Epic Games account from your EA Account to link it to a different EA Account. Epic Games will install your game and let you know when it’s ready to play.Log in to the EA app using your EA Account info, or create a new EA Account.The EA app will launch and ask you to link your Epic Games account and your EA Account.Go to your Library, choose your EA game, and click Install.Install the EA app if you haven’t already.You’ll only be asked to link your accounts the first time you play an EA game on Epic Games. Reminder: Underage EA Accounts can’t link to Epic Games accounts. You can only link one Epic Games account to an EA account, so make sure you choose the right EA Account to link to.
